projects
/
mesa.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
anv: advertise v6 of the wayland surface extension
[mesa.git]
/
src
/
intel
/
vulkan
/
anv_device.c
2017-07-17
Emil Velikov
anv: advertise v6 of the wayland surface extension
blob
|
commitdiff
|
raw
2017-07-17
Lionel Landwerlin
anv: ensure device name contains terminating character
blob
|
commitdiff
|
raw
|
diff to current
2017-07-15
Jason Ekstrand
anv: Implement VK_KHR_external_memory_*
blob
|
commitdiff
|
raw
|
diff to current
2017-07-15
Jason Ekstrand
anv: Implement VK_KHR_dedicated_allocation
blob
|
commitdiff
|
raw
|
diff to current
2017-07-15
Jason Ekstrand
anv: Implement VK_KHR_get_memory_requirements2
blob
|
commitdiff
|
raw
|
diff to current
2017-07-15
Jason Ekstrand
anv: Advertise version 1.0.54
blob
|
commitdiff
|
raw
|
diff to current
2017-07-15
Jason Ekstrand
anv: Drop support for VK_KHX_external_semaphore_*
blob
|
commitdiff
|
raw
|
diff to current
2017-07-15
Jason Ekstrand
anv: Drop support for VK_KHX_external_memory_*
blob
|
commitdiff
|
raw
|
diff to current
2017-07-13
Lionel Landwerlin
anv: don't use strcpy for copying strings
blob
|
commitdiff
|
raw
|
diff to current
2017-07-10
Kenneth Graunke
intel: Move clflush helpers from anv to common/gen_clfl...
blob
|
commitdiff
|
raw
|
diff to current
2017-07-03
Samuel Iglesias...
anv: check support for enabled features in vkCreateDevice()
blob
|
commitdiff
|
raw
|
diff to current
2017-07-02
Lionel Landwerlin
anv: fix reported timestampPeriod value
blob
|
commitdiff
|
raw
|
diff to current
2017-06-29
Lionel Landwerlin
anv: use devinfo for number of thread/eu
blob
|
commitdiff
|
raw
|
diff to current
2017-06-27
Topi Pohjolainen
intel/anv: Add missing break in anv_CreateDevice()
blob
|
commitdiff
|
raw
|
diff to current
2017-06-22
Anuj Phogat
anv/cnl: Generate and use gen10 functions
blob
|
commitdiff
|
raw
|
diff to current
2017-06-19
Lionel Landwerlin
intel: common: express timestamps units in frequency
blob
|
commitdiff
|
raw
|
diff to current
2017-06-09
Jason Ekstrand
anv: Don't advertise support on anything above gen9
blob
|
commitdiff
|
raw
|
diff to current
2017-06-06
Alex Smith
anv: Set better descriptor set limits
blob
|
commitdiff
|
raw
|
diff to current
2017-06-06
Alex Smith
anv: Set driver version to Mesa version
blob
|
commitdiff
|
raw
|
diff to current
2017-06-06
Alex Smith
util/vulkan: Move Vulkan utilities to src/vulkan/util
blob
|
commitdiff
|
raw
|
diff to current
2017-05-24
Jason Ekstrand
anv: Require vertex buffers to come from a 32-bit heap
blob
|
commitdiff
|
raw
|
diff to current
2017-05-24
Jason Ekstrand
anv: Advertise both 32-bit and 48-bit heaps when we...
blob
|
commitdiff
|
raw
|
diff to current
2017-05-23
Jason Ekstrand
anv: Refactor memory type setup
blob
|
commitdiff
|
raw
|
diff to current
2017-05-23
Jason Ekstrand
anv: Make supports_48bit_addresses a heap property
blob
|
commitdiff
|
raw
|
diff to current
2017-05-23
Jason Ekstrand
anv: Stop setting BO flags in bo_init_new
blob
|
commitdiff
|
raw
|
diff to current
2017-05-23
Jason Ekstrand
anv: Set image memory types based on the type count
blob
|
commitdiff
|
raw
|
diff to current
2017-05-23
Jason Ekstrand
anv: Add valid_bufer_usage to the memory type metadata
blob
|
commitdiff
|
raw
|
diff to current
2017-05-23
Jason Ekstrand
anv: Determine the type of mapping based on type metadata
blob
|
commitdiff
|
raw
|
diff to current
2017-05-23
Jason Ekstrand
anv: Set up memory types and heaps during physical...
blob
|
commitdiff
|
raw
|
diff to current
2017-05-23
Jason Ekstrand
anv: Predicate 48bit support on gen >= 8
blob
|
commitdiff
|
raw
|
diff to current
2017-05-16
Jason Ekstrand
anv: Implement VK_KHR_get_surface_capabilities2
blob
|
commitdiff
|
raw
|
diff to current
2017-05-09
Grazvydas Ignotas
anv: don't leak DRM devices
blob
|
commitdiff
|
raw
|
diff to current
2017-05-09
Grazvydas Ignotas
anv: fix possible stack corruption
blob
|
commitdiff
|
raw
|
diff to current
2017-05-05
Jason Ekstrand
anv: Drop the instruction pool block size
blob
|
commitdiff
|
raw
|
diff to current
2017-05-05
Jason Ekstrand
anv/allocator: Embed the block_pool in the state_pool
blob
|
commitdiff
|
raw
|
diff to current
2017-05-05
Jason Ekstrand
anv/allocator: Drop the block_size field from block_pool
blob
|
commitdiff
|
raw
|
diff to current
2017-05-03
Jason Ekstrand
anv: Implement VK_KHX_external_semaphore_fd
blob
|
commitdiff
|
raw
|
diff to current
2017-05-03
Jason Ekstrand
anv: Implement VK_KHX_external_semaphore
blob
|
commitdiff
|
raw
|
diff to current
2017-05-03
Jason Ekstrand
anv: Implement VK_KHX_external_semaphore_capabilities
blob
|
commitdiff
|
raw
|
diff to current
2017-05-03
Jason Ekstrand
anv: Trivially implement multiDrawIndirect
blob
|
commitdiff
|
raw
|
diff to current
2017-05-03
Jason Ekstrand
anv: Enable VK_KHX_multiview and SPV_KHR_multiview
blob
|
commitdiff
|
raw
|
diff to current
2017-05-03
Jason Ekstrand
anv: Add the KHX_multiview boilerplate
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Jason Ekstrand
anv: Alphabetize KHR extensions
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Jason Ekstrand
anv: Move queues, events, and semaphores to their own...
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Jason Ekstrand
anv: Implement VK_KHX_external_memory_fd
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Jason Ekstrand
anv: Use the BO cache for DeviceMemory allocations
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Jason Ekstrand
anv: Implement VK_KHX_external_memory
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Chad Versace
anv: Implement VK_KHX_external_memory_capabilities
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Jason Ekstrand
anv/physical_device: Rename uuid to pipeline_cache_uuid
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Jason Ekstrand
anv: Refactor device_get_cache_uuid into physical_devic...
blob
|
commitdiff
|
raw
|
diff to current
2017-04-28
Jason Ekstrand
anv: Set EXEC_OBJECT_ASYNC when available
blob
|
commitdiff
|
raw
|
diff to current
2017-04-15
Jason Ekstrand
anv: Add the pci_id into the shader cache UUID
blob
|
commitdiff
|
raw
|
diff to current
2017-04-14
Jason Ekstrand
anv: Limit VkDeviceMemory objects to 2GB
blob
|
commitdiff
|
raw
|
diff to current
2017-04-06
Jason Ekstrand
anv/device: Add a helper for querying whether a BO...
blob
|
commitdiff
|
raw
|
diff to current
2017-04-05
Jason Ekstrand
anv: Advertise larger heap sizes
blob
|
commitdiff
|
raw
|
diff to current
2017-04-05
Jason Ekstrand
anv: Add support for 48-bit addresses
blob
|
commitdiff
|
raw
|
diff to current
2017-04-05
Jason Ekstrand
anv: Query the kernel for reset status
blob
|
commitdiff
|
raw
|
diff to current
2017-04-05
Jason Ekstrand
anv: Check for device loss at the end of WaitForFences
blob
|
commitdiff
|
raw
|
diff to current
2017-04-03
Jason Ekstrand
anv: Implement VK_KHR_incremental_present
blob
|
commitdiff
|
raw
|
diff to current
2017-03-24
Iago Toral Quiroga
anv: return VK_ERROR_DEVICE_LOST immeditely when device...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-24
Iago Toral Quiroga
anv/device: keep track of 'device lost' state
blob
|
commitdiff
|
raw
|
diff to current
2017-03-24
Iago Toral Quiroga
anv/device: return VK_ERROR_DEVICE_LOST for errors...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-22
Jason Ekstrand
anv/device: Move push descriptor query handling
blob
|
commitdiff
|
raw
|
diff to current
2017-03-17
Jason Ekstrand
anv: Turn on inherited queries
blob
|
commitdiff
|
raw
|
diff to current
2017-03-17
Ilia Mirkin
anv: Implement pipeline statistics queries
blob
|
commitdiff
|
raw
|
diff to current
2017-03-17
Robert Bragg
anv/device: init timestampPeriod from devinfo
blob
|
commitdiff
|
raw
|
diff to current
2017-03-17
Jason Ekstrand
anv/device: Remove a use of a compound literal
blob
|
commitdiff
|
raw
|
diff to current
2017-03-16
Iago Toral Quiroga
anv/device: assert that commands submitted to a queue...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-15
Emil Velikov
anv: do not open random render node(s)
blob
|
commitdiff
|
raw
|
diff to current
2017-03-14
Jason Ekstrand
anv: Properly enumerate physical devices when none...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-14
Gwan-gyeong Mun
anv: Add missing error-checking to anv_CreateDevice...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-13
Chad Versace
anv: Use vk_outarray in vkGetPhysicalDeviceQueueFamilyP...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-13
Chad Versace
anv: Use vk_outarray in vkEnumeratePhysicalDevices...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-13
Jason Ekstrand
anv: Accurately advertise dynamic descriptor limits
blob
|
commitdiff
|
raw
|
diff to current
2017-03-07
Jason Ekstrand
anv: Get rid of the stub() macros
blob
|
commitdiff
|
raw
|
diff to current
2017-03-03
Jason Ekstrand
anv: Advertise shaderInt64 on Broadwell and above
blob
|
commitdiff
|
raw
|
diff to current
2017-03-02
Lionel Landwerlin
anv: add VK_KHR_descriptor_update_template support
blob
|
commitdiff
|
raw
|
diff to current
2017-03-02
Lionel Landwerlin
anv: add VK_KHR_push_descriptor support
blob
|
commitdiff
|
raw
|
diff to current
2017-03-01
Jason Ekstrand
util/build-id: Return a pointer rather than copying...
blob
|
commitdiff
|
raw
|
diff to current
2017-03-01
Jason Ekstrand
anv: Properly handle destroying NULL devices and instances
blob
|
commitdiff
|
raw
|
diff to current
2017-02-27
Jason Ekstrand
anv: Bump advertised version to 1.0.42
blob
|
commitdiff
|
raw
|
diff to current
2017-02-21
Jason Ekstrand
anv: Take a device parameter in anv_state_flush
blob
|
commitdiff
|
raw
|
diff to current
2017-02-21
Jason Ekstrand
anv: Pull all clflushing into a clflush_range helper
blob
|
commitdiff
|
raw
|
diff to current
2017-02-21
Jason Ekstrand
anv: Rename clflush_range and state_clflush
blob
|
commitdiff
|
raw
|
diff to current
2017-02-21
Emil Velikov
anv: remove unused anv_dispatch_table dtable
blob
|
commitdiff
|
raw
|
diff to current
2017-02-20
Dave Airlie
vulkan/wsi/x11: add support to detect if we can support...
blob
|
commitdiff
|
raw
|
diff to current
2017-02-15
Matt Turner
anv: Use build-id for pipeline cache UUID.
blob
|
commitdiff
|
raw
|
diff to current
2017-02-15
Jason Ekstrand
anv: Use vk_foreach_struct for handling extension structs
blob
|
commitdiff
|
raw
|
diff to current
2017-02-14
Connor Abbott
anv: fix Get*MemoryRequirements for !LLC
blob
|
commitdiff
|
raw
|
diff to current
2017-02-14
Alex Smith
anv: Add support for shaderStorageImageWriteWithoutFormat
blob
|
commitdiff
|
raw
|
diff to current
2017-02-02
Lionel Landwerlin
anv: enable VK_KHR_shader_draw_parameters
blob
|
commitdiff
|
raw
|
diff to current
2017-02-02
Lionel Landwerlin
anv: limit vertex buffers to 31
blob
|
commitdiff
|
raw
|
diff to current
2017-01-27
Jason Ekstrand
anv: Advertise API version 1.0.39
blob
|
commitdiff
|
raw
|
diff to current
2017-01-26
Chad Versace
anv: Implement VK_KHR_get_physical_device_properties2
blob
|
commitdiff
|
raw
|
diff to current
2017-01-26
Chad Versace
anv: Refactor anv_GetPhysicalDeviceQueueFamilyProperties()
blob
|
commitdiff
|
raw
|
diff to current
2017-01-24
Jason Ekstrand
anv: Expose VK_KHR_maintenance1
blob
|
commitdiff
|
raw
|
diff to current
2017-01-17
Samuel Iglesias...
anv: increase ANV_MAX_STATE_SIZE_LOG2 limit to 1 MB
blob
|
commitdiff
|
raw
|
diff to current
2017-01-12
Chad Versace
anv: Support loader interface version 3 (patch v2)
blob
|
commitdiff
|
raw
|
diff to current
2017-01-10
Kenneth Graunke
anv: Enable tessellation shaders.
blob
|
commitdiff
|
raw
|
diff to current
2017-01-10
Kenneth Graunke
anv: Initialize physical device limits for tessellation
blob
|
commitdiff
|
raw
|
diff to current
next